Home
last modified time | relevance | path

Searched refs:extents (Results 1 – 15 of 15) sorted by relevance

/qemu/tests/qemu-iotests/
H A D237.out23 extents:
37 …{"job-id": "job0", "options": {"adapter-type": "ide", "driver": "vmdk", "extents": [], "file": {"d…
50 extents:
64 …-id": "job0", "options": {"adapter-type": "buslogic", "driver": "vmdk", "extents": [], "file": {"d…
77 extents:
142 …-create", "arguments": {"job-id": "job0", "options": {"driver": "vmdk", "extents": ["ext1"], "file…
149 …-create", "arguments": {"job-id": "job0", "options": {"driver": "vmdk", "extents": ["ext1", "ext2"…
151 Job failed: List of extents contains unused extents
159 …-create", "arguments": {"job-id": "job0", "options": {"driver": "vmdk", "extents": ["ext1"], "file…
171 extents:
[all …]
H A D237219 extents = [ "ext%d" % (i) for i in range(1, num_extents + 1) ] variable
226 'extents': extents })
H A D059.out34 extents:
2344 === Testing qemu-img map on extents ===
/qemu/qapi/
H A Dcxl.json392 # The policy to use for selecting which extents comprise the added
398 # supported extents.
404 # @prescriptive: The precise set of extents to be allocated is
416 # extents provided to each host is indicated to the host using per
433 # Initiate adding dynamic capacity extents to a host. This simulates
447 # which extents comprise the added capacity.
456 # @extents: The "Extent List" field as defined in Compute Express Link
471 'extents': [ 'CxlDynamicCapacityExtent' ]
479 # The policy to use for selecting which extents comprise the released
484 # no requirement for contiguous extents.
[all …]
H A Dblock-core.json120 # @extents: List of extent files
129 'extents': ['VmdkExtentInfo']
143 # @cluster-size: Cluster size in bytes (for non-flat extents)
5333 # @extents: Where to store the data extents. Required for
5338 # more extents than will be used is an error.
5363 '*extents': ['BlockdevRef'],
/qemu/block/
H A Dvmdk.c175 VmdkExtent *extents; member
277 e = &s->extents[i]; in vmdk_free_extents()
289 g_free(s->extents);
300 s->extents = g_renew(VmdkExtent, s->extents, s->num_extents);
445 * Check whether there are any extents stored in bs->file; if bs->file in vmdk_reopen_prepare()
450 rs->extents_using_bs_file[i] = s->extents[i].file == state->bs->file; in vmdk_reopen_prepare()
476 s->extents[i].file = state->bs->file; in vmdk_reopen_commit()
572 s->extents = g_renew(VmdkExtent, s->extents, in vmdk_add_extent()
[all...]
/qemu/nbd/
H A Dserver.c2263 NBDExtent64 *extents; member
2279 ea->extents = g_new(NBDExtent64, nb_alloc); in nbd_extent_array_new()
2288 g_free(ea->extents); in nbd_extent_array_free()
2304 ea->extents[i].length = cpu_to_be64(ea->extents[i].length); in G_DEFINE_AUTOPTR_CLEANUP_FUNC()
2305 ea->extents[i].flags = cpu_to_be64(ea->extents[i].flags); in G_DEFINE_AUTOPTR_CLEANUP_FUNC()
2313 NBDExtent32 *extents = g_new(NBDExtent32, ea->count); in nbd_extent_array_convert_to_narrow() local
2321 assert((ea->extents[i].length | ea->extents[i].flags) <= UINT32_MAX); in nbd_extent_array_convert_to_narrow()
2322 extents[i].length = cpu_to_be32(ea->extents[i].length); in nbd_extent_array_convert_to_narrow()
2323 extents[i].flags = cpu_to_be32(ea->extents[i].flags); in nbd_extent_array_convert_to_narrow()
2326 return extents; in nbd_extent_array_convert_to_narrow()
[all …]
H A Dtrace-events71 …igned int extents, uint32_t id, uint64_t length, int last) "Send block status reply: cookie = %" P…
/qemu/hw/mem/
H A Dcxl_type3_stubs.c76 CxlDynamicCapacityExtentList *extents, in qmp_cxl_add_dynamic_capacity() argument
90 CxlDynamicCapacityExtentList *extents, in qmp_cxl_release_dynamic_capacity() argument
H A Dcxl_type3.c686 QTAILQ_INIT(&ct3d->dc.extents); in cxl_create_dc_regions()
699 QTAILQ_FOREACH_SAFE(ent, &ct3d->dc.extents, node, ent_next) { in cxl_destroy_dc_regions()
700 cxl_remove_extent_from_extent_list(&ct3d->dc.extents, ent); in cxl_destroy_dc_regions()
1968 g_autofree CXLDCExtentRaw *extents = NULL; in qmp_cxl_process_dynamic_capacity_prescriptive() local
2037 if (cxl_extents_overlaps_dpa_range(&dcd->dc.extents, dpa, len)) { in qmp_cxl_process_dynamic_capacity_prescriptive()
2056 extents = g_new0(CXLDCExtentRaw, num_extents); in qmp_cxl_process_dynamic_capacity_prescriptive()
2062 extents[i].start_dpa = dpa; in qmp_cxl_process_dynamic_capacity_prescriptive()
2063 extents[i].len = len; in qmp_cxl_process_dynamic_capacity_prescriptive()
2064 memset(extents[i].tag, 0, 0x10); in qmp_cxl_process_dynamic_capacity_prescriptive()
2065 extents[i].shared_seq = 0; in qmp_cxl_process_dynamic_capacity_prescriptive()
[all …]
/qemu/contrib/vhost-user-gpu/
H A Dvhost-user-gpu.c789 pixman_box16_t *extents; in vg_resource_flush() local
802 extents = pixman_region_extents(&finalregion); in vg_resource_flush()
803 size_t width = extents->x2 - extents->x1; in vg_resource_flush()
804 size_t height = extents->y2 - extents->y1; in vg_resource_flush()
812 .x = extents->x1, in vg_resource_flush()
813 .y = extents->y1, in vg_resource_flush()
832 .x = extents->x1, in vg_resource_flush()
833 .y = extents->y1, in vg_resource_flush()
846 extents->x1, extents->y1, in vg_resource_flush()
/qemu/docs/interop/
H A Dnbd.rst32 Each dirty-bitmap metadata context defines only one flag for extents
38 The second is related to exposing the source of various extents within
/qemu/qga/
H A Dcommands-win32.c905 PVOLUME_DISK_EXTENTS extents = NULL; in build_guest_disk_info() local
924 extents = g_malloc0(size); in build_guest_disk_info()
926 0, extents, size, &size, NULL)) { in build_guest_disk_info()
931 (sizeof(DISK_EXTENT) * (extents->NumberOfDiskExtents - 1)); in build_guest_disk_info()
932 g_free(extents); in build_guest_disk_info()
933 extents = g_malloc0(size); in build_guest_disk_info()
936 0, extents, size, NULL, NULL)) { in build_guest_disk_info()
962 g_debug("Number of extents: %lu", extents->NumberOfDiskExtents); in build_guest_disk_info()
965 for (i = 0; i < extents->NumberOfDiskExtents; i++) { in build_guest_disk_info()
977 extents->Extents[i].DiskNumber); in build_guest_disk_info()
[all …]
/qemu/hw/cxl/
H A Dcxl-mailbox-utils.c2748 CXLDCExtentList *extent_list = &ct3d->dc.extents; in cmd_dcd_get_dyn_cap_ext_list()
2989 QTAILQ_FOREACH(ent, &ct3d->dc.extents, node) { in cxl_dcd_add_dyn_cap_rsp_dry_run()
3013 CXLDCExtentList *extent_list = &ct3d->dc.extents; in cmd_dcd_add_dyn_cap_rsp()
3095 copy_extent_list(updated_list, &ct3d->dc.extents); in cxl_dc_extent_release_dry_run()
3216 QTAILQ_FOREACH_SAFE(ent, &ct3d->dc.extents, node, ent_next) { in cmd_dcd_release_dyn_cap()
3218 cxl_remove_extent_from_extent_list(&ct3d->dc.extents, ent); in cmd_dcd_release_dyn_cap()
3220 copy_extent_list(&ct3d->dc.extents, &updated_list); in cmd_dcd_release_dyn_cap()
/qemu/include/hw/cxl/
H A Dcxl_device.h618 CXLDCExtentList extents; member